Ingredients for the Best Fudgy Chewy Brookies
Essential Ingredients for Fudgy Brookies
Creating the best fudgy chewy brookies begins with the right ingredients. The blend of chocolate chip cookies and brownies is magical, and using high-quality ingredients will elevate your baking game tremendously.
Here’s what you’ll need:
- All-purpose flour: Provides structure but allows for that chewy texture.
- Unsweetened cocoa powder: The key player in developing those rich, chocolatey flavors.
- Brown sugar: Use this to bring out the chewy texture; it’s moister than granulated sugar.
- Butter: Opt for unsalted, as it allows you to control the saltiness in your treat.
- Eggs: For moisture and richness—two large eggs usually do the trick!
- Chocolate chips: Go for semi-sweet for that classic balance of sweet and rich.
- Vanilla extract: A splash adds warmth to the flavor profile.

Gather Your Ingredients and Tools
The first step to crafting delicious brookies is gathering all your ingredients and tools. Here’s what you’ll need:
Ingredients:
- 1 cup unsalted butter
- 1 cup semi-sweet chocolate chips
- 2 large eggs
- 1 cup granulated sugar
- 1 cup brown sugar, packed
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- 1 cup all-purpose flour
- ½ teaspoon baking powder
- ½ teaspoon salt
- 1 cup cookie dough (store-bought or homemade)
Tools:
- Mixing bowls
- Microwave-safe container for melting chocolate
- Whisk or electric mixer
- Baking sheet
- Parchment paper

Melting the Chocolate and Butter Mixture
The heart of your brookies is the rich chocolate flavor. To achieve this, melt the butter and chocolate chips together. Place both in a microwave-safe container and heat in 20-second intervals until smooth. Stirring frequently helps to prevent any burning. This step not only makes mixing easier but also enhances the flavor—trust me, the aroma alone will get your taste buds excited!
Whipping Eggs and Sugars for That Perfect Texture
Next, in a large bowl, whip the eggs with both the granulated and brown sugars until the mixture is fluffy and light. This process incorporates air, setting the stage for your brookies to achieve that fudgy texture we’re after. The sugars will also caramelize a bit while baking, giving your brookies an irresistible flavor. Pro tip: Add a teaspoon of vanilla extract before mixing to elevate the taste further!
Mixing Dry Ingredients for the Ultimate Brookie Blend
In a separate bowl, combine the all-purpose flour, baking powder, and salt. Sifting these together helps to avoid any lumps and ensures an even distribution of the baking powder, which is crucial for that perfect rise. Incorporating this dry mixture later ensures that your brookies won’t end up overly dense or cakey.
Combining Wet and Dry Mixtures Without Losing Airiness
Gentle is the name of the game here. Pour the melted chocolate and butter into the egg-sugar mixture and stir to combine. Slowly fold in your dry ingredients, being careful not to overmix. The goal is to keep that airiness intact while ensuring just enough flour is included to create the fudgy texture of the best fudgy chewy brookies. It should look a little like thick brownie batter.
Baking the Brookies to Fudgy Perfection
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) while you prepare your baking sheet with parchment paper. Scoop out the cookie dough, placing it alongside dollops of your brownie batter on the sheet—yes, it can just be a big mix! Bake these for about 20-25 minutes. You want the edges to look set but the center slightly underbaked for that gooey goodness.
Cooling and Finishing Touches
Once they’re out, resist the urge to dive in immediately! Allowing them to cool on the baking sheet for about 10 minutes helps the texture settle, making it easier to enjoy later. For an extra touch, sprinkle a little sea salt on top before serving—this enhances the chocolate flavor and takes your brookies to new heights.

Baking Notes for the Best Fudgy Chewy Brookies
Tips for melting chocolate successfully
To create the best fudgy chewy brookies, mastering the art of melting chocolate is essential. Opt for a double boiler or a microwave in short bursts (about 20-30 seconds), stirring in between to prevent scorching. Avoid high heat, as it can seize the chocolate. If you need a quick guide, check out resources from the Chocolate Manufacturers Association for best practices.
Ensuring even baking and cooling
To achieve uniformly baked brookies, make sure your oven temperature is accurate—consider using an oven thermometer, as they can be surprisingly off. Spread the batters in the pan evenly, ideally using an offset spatula, ensuring each layer gets the same care. Once out of the oven, let them cool in the pan for about 10 minutes to set before transferring them to a wire rack. This step is critical; it helps retain their fudgy consistency while cooling down.

Tips for Making Perfect Fudgy Chewy Brookies
Importance of Ingredient Temperature
When crafting the best fudgy chewy brookies, ingredient temperature can be your unsung hero. Softened butter and room-temperature eggs create a smoother batter that blends beautifully, resulting in that perfect fudgy texture. If your ingredients are too cold, you might end up with a clumpy dough that’s tough to mix. Take a few minutes to let those ingredients come to room temperature—it makes a world of difference!
How to Store Brookies for Freshness
Once you’ve baked your delicious brookies, you’ll want to keep them fresh for as long as possible. Store your brookies in an airtight container at room temperature to maintain their chewy goodness. If you plan to indulge later, consider wrapping them individually in plastic wrap and then placing them in a freezer bag to enjoy them at a later date. FAQs about the Best Fudgy Chewy Brookies
Can I use different types of sugar in the recipe?
Absolutely! While the recipe recommends granulated sugar and brown sugar for balancing sweetness and chewiness, feel free to experiment with alternatives like coconut sugar or organic cane sugar. Just remember that different sugars can affect moisture levels—so keep an eye on consistency!
What should I do if my brookies turn out too dry?
Dry brookies can be a real disappointment, but don’t fret! Here are some tips to achieve the best fudgy chewy brookies next time:
- Reduce Baking Time: Overbaking is a common culprit. Keep an eye on them during the last few minutes. They should be slightly gooey in the middle.
- Add More Moisture: Consider increasing the fat in your recipe. Adding an extra tablespoon of butter or oil can help retain moisture.
- Store Properly: Once they cool, keep your brookies in an airtight container. This helps maintain that desirable tenderness.
How can I adjust the recipe for dietary restrictions?
If you have dietary restrictions, you can still enjoy the best fudgy chewy brookies with a few modifications:
- Gluten-Free: Swap all-purpose flour with a gluten-free blend for a seamless transition.
- Vegan: Replace eggs with flaxseed meal mixed with water, and use plant-based butter or oil.
- Sugar-Free Options: If you’re watching your sugar intake, consider using a stevia blend or erythritol, adjusting the quantities carefully.

PrintThe Best Fudgy Chewy Brookies: A Deliciously Indulgent Treat
The BEST Fudgy Chewy Brookies are the perfect combination of brownie and cookie, providing a rich and scrumptious dessert experience.
- Prep Time: 15 minutes
- Cook Time: 30 minutes
- Total Time: 45 minutes
- Yield: 24 servings 1x
- Category: Dessert
- Method: Baking
- Cuisine: American
- Diet: Vegetarian
Ingredients
- 1 cup unsalted butter
- 2 cups granulated sugar
- 4 large eggs
- 2 teaspoons vanilla extract
- 2 cups all-purpose flour
- 1 cup cocoa powder
- 1 teaspoon baking powder
- 1/2 teaspoon salt
- 1 cup chocolate chips
Instructions
-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C).
- In a large bowl, cream together the butter and sugar until smooth.
- Add the eggs and vanilla extract, mixing well.
- In a separate bowl, combine the flour, cocoa powder, baking powder, and salt.
- Gradually add the dry ingredients to the wet mixture and stir until well combined.
- Fold in the chocolate chips.
- Pour the batter into a greased baking pan and spread evenly.
- Bake for 25-30 minutes, or until a toothpick comes out clean.
- Let cool before serving.
Notes
- For a more intense chocolate flavor, add extra chocolate chips.
- These brookies can be enjoyed warm or at room temperature.
